当前位置: 首页 > article >正文

5分钟快速上手tracetcp:TCP路由追踪工具的终极指南

5分钟快速上手tracetcpTCP路由追踪工具的终极指南【免费下载链接】tracetcptracetcp. Traceroute utility that uses tcp syn packets to trace network routes.项目地址: https://gitcode.com/gh_mirrors/tr/tracetcptracetcp是一款专业的TCP路由追踪工具它使用TCP SYN数据包而非传统的ICMP/UDP数据包进行网络路径探测。这款免费的网络诊断工具能够穿透防火墙限制精准定位网络连接问题是网络管理员和开发者的必备利器。在本文中我们将详细介绍tracetcp的核心功能、安装方法和实用技巧帮助您快速掌握这款强大的网络诊断工具。 tracetcp为什么比传统traceroute更强大传统网络诊断工具如traceroute使用ICMP或UDP数据包容易被网络设备过滤或阻止。而tracetcp采用TCP SYN数据包进行路由追踪这种方式更贴近真实应用的连接过程能够有效绕过防火墙限制。主要优势对比协议优势TCP SYN vs ICMP/UDP穿透能力有效穿透防火墙端口针对性支持任意TCP端口检测结果准确性更真实的网络路径映射 快速安装与配置环境要求在开始使用tracetcp之前您需要先安装WinPCAP库。这是tracetcp正常运行的必要条件。安装步骤从WinPCAP官网下载并安装最新版本从项目仓库获取tracetcp可执行文件git clone https://gitcode.com/gh_mirrors/tr/tracetcp将tracetcp.exe复制到系统PATH目录中验证安装打开命令提示符输入以下命令验证安装是否成功tracetcp -v 基础命令快速上手基本语法tracetcp 目标地址[:端口] [选项]实用示例示例1追踪网站路由tracetcp www.baidu.com:443这个命令将追踪到百度HTTPS服务的完整网络路径。示例2追踪邮件服务器tracetcp mail.example.com:smtp -n使用-n参数禁用DNS反向解析可以显著提高追踪速度。示例3快速诊断模式tracetcp api.service.com:8080 -m 20 -p 1 -F这个组合参数适合快速网络问题排查能够在保证基本准确性的前提下大幅提升效率。⚙️ 高级参数详解常用参数速查表参数功能说明适用场景-m最大跳数限制避免无限追踪-h起始跳数设置跳过已知路由段-t超时时间配置网络不稳定时使用-c简洁输出模式结果保存与分析-n禁用DNS解析提高追踪效率-p每跳探测包数统计延迟数据-F禁用防洪计时器快速初步排查-r端口范围测试检测端口过滤-s简易端口扫描快速端口检测参数组合方案精确分析模式tracetcp target.example.com:443 -t 2000 -p 5在网络状况不稳定时使用通过增加探测包数量和延长超时时间获得更具统计意义的延迟数据。端口扫描模式tracetcp target.example.com -s 20 80快速扫描20-80端口检测哪些端口是开放的。 实际应用场景场景1网站无法访问诊断当网站无法访问但ping命令显示正常时使用tracetcp可以揭示被隐藏的网络问题tracetcp www.example.com:80 -m 30 -n场景2邮件服务器连接问题排查SMTP服务器连接问题tracetcp mail.server.com:smtp -t 3000场景3游戏服务器延迟优化定位游戏服务器特定端口的延迟问题tracetcp game.server.com:27015 -p 3场景4防火墙规则检测检测特定端口是否被防火墙阻止tracetcp target.server.com:135 -h 1 -m 3 结果解读技巧理解输出格式tracetcp的输出包含以下信息跳数数据包经过的网络节点IP地址每个节点的网络地址主机名节点的DNS名称如果启用延迟时间往返时间毫秒状态连接成功或超时常见结果分析*符号表示该节点未响应可能是网络设备过滤或超时超时响应可能表示防火墙阻止或网络拥堵连接成功目标端口开放且可达 故障排除指南问题1需要管理员权限tracetcp需要管理员权限才能正常运行。请确保以管理员身份运行命令提示符。问题2WinPCAP未安装如果遇到WinPCAP相关错误请确保已正确安装WinPCAP库并重启系统。问题3网络适配器问题某些网络适配器可能不支持数据包捕获功能。尝试使用其他网络接口或更新驱动程序。问题4防火墙干扰某些安全软件可能会干扰tracetcp的正常运行。暂时禁用防火墙或添加例外规则。 专业使用技巧技巧1批量测试脚本创建批处理文件进行多个目标的测试echo off for %%i in (80 443 8080) do ( echo Testing port %%i tracetcp target.example.com:%%i -n -c results.txt )技巧2结果保存与分析将追踪结果保存到文件以便后续分析tracetcp target.example.com:443 trace_result.txt技巧3自定义源端口测试当怀疑目标服务器对特定源端口有过滤时tracetcp target.example.com:443 -r 1024 2048技巧4网络路径对比对比不同时间段或不同网络环境下的路由变化tracetcp target.example.com:443 -n trace_morning.txt tracetcp target.example.com:443 -n trace_evening.txt 深入学习资源核心源码模块想要深入了解tracetcp的实现原理可以查看以下核心模块网络层实现net/Socket.cpp - 网络套接字处理数据包处理packet/PacketInterface.cpp - 数据包接口命令行解析neo/CommandOptionParser.cpp - 参数解析输出格式化StandardTraceOutput.cpp - 标准输出格式官方文档完整的项目文档和使用说明可以在docs/html/目录中找到包括详细的HTML文档和示例。 总结tracetcp作为一款专业的TCP路由追踪工具为网络诊断提供了全新的视角。通过使用TCP SYN数据包它能够穿透传统工具无法通过的防火墙限制提供更准确的网络路径信息。无论是日常网络维护、服务器部署调试还是网络安全分析tracetcp都是一个强大而实用的工具。掌握它的使用技巧您将能够快速定位和解决各种网络连接问题。现在就开始使用tracetcp让您的网络诊断工作更加高效和精准【免费下载链接】tracetcptracetcp. Traceroute utility that uses tcp syn packets to trace network routes.项目地址: https://gitcode.com/gh_mirrors/tr/tracetcp创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

5分钟快速上手tracetcp:TCP路由追踪工具的终极指南

5分钟快速上手tracetcp:TCP路由追踪工具的终极指南 【免费下载链接】tracetcp tracetcp. Traceroute utility that uses tcp syn packets to trace network routes. 项目地址: https://gitcode.com/gh_mirrors/tr/tracetcp tracetcp是一款专业的TCP路由追踪…...

如何在微服务架构中实现统一授权:Cerbos的终极解决方案

如何在微服务架构中实现统一授权:Cerbos的终极解决方案 【免费下载链接】cerbos Cerbos is the open core, language-agnostic, scalable authorization solution that makes user permissions and authorization simple to implement and manage by writing contex…...

5分钟快速上手:tts-vue微软语音合成工具完全指南 [特殊字符]

5分钟快速上手:tts-vue微软语音合成工具完全指南 🎤 【免费下载链接】tts-vue 🎤 微软语音合成工具,使用 Electron Vue ElementPlus Vite 构建。 项目地址: https://gitcode.com/gh_mirrors/tt/tts-vue 想要将文字转化为…...

Mermaid Live Editor:解决技术文档图表制作的5个核心痛点

Mermaid Live Editor:解决技术文档图表制作的5个核心痛点 【免费下载链接】mermaid-live-editor Edit, preview and share mermaid charts/diagrams. New implementation of the live editor. 项目地址: https://gitcode.com/GitHub_Trending/me/mermaid-live-edi…...

Jable视频下载工具架构深度解析:浏览器扩展与本地协议协同方案

Jable视频下载工具架构深度解析:浏览器扩展与本地协议协同方案 【免费下载链接】jable-download 方便下载jable的小工具 项目地址: https://gitcode.com/gh_mirrors/ja/jable-download Jable视频下载工具通过创新的浏览器扩展与本地协议协同架构,…...

OFA模型与Dify平台集成:可视化构建无代码图像描述AI应用

OFA模型与Dify平台集成:可视化构建无代码图像描述AI应用 你有没有遇到过这样的场景?产品经理或运营同事拿着几张图片跑过来,问你能不能快速做一个“看图说话”的小工具,用来给商品图自动配文案,或者给活动海报生成描述…...

Applite:让Homebrew Casks变得像逛应用商店一样简单

Applite:让Homebrew Casks变得像逛应用商店一样简单 【免费下载链接】Applite User-friendly GUI macOS application for Homebrew Casks 项目地址: https://gitcode.com/gh_mirrors/ap/Applite 你知道吗?在macOS上安装应用其实可以不用打开浏览器…...

ComfyUI-Manager终极指南:5分钟掌握AI绘画扩展管理

ComfyUI-Manager终极指南:5分钟掌握AI绘画扩展管理 【免费下载链接】ComfyUI-Manager ComfyUI-Manager is an extension designed to enhance the usability of ComfyUI. It offers management functions to install, remove, disable, and enable various custom n…...

深入GD32F450 GPIO寄存器:告别库函数依赖,自己动手配置AF复用与上下拉

深入GD32F450 GPIO寄存器:从库函数到寄存器级精准控制 在嵌入式开发领域,对GPIO的精确控制往往是项目成败的关键因素之一。当你的项目需要处理高频信号、严格时序或超低功耗场景时,标准库函数可能成为性能瓶颈。GD32F450作为一款高性能微控制…...

告别手动刷UDS!用CANoe.Diva Demo工程5分钟上手诊断自动化测试

告别手动刷UDS!用CANoe.Diva Demo工程5分钟上手诊断自动化测试 还在为手动执行UDS诊断测试而烦恼?每次测试都要重复输入相同的指令,既耗时又容易出错。CANoe.Diva的自动化测试功能可以彻底改变这一现状,而它的Demo工程更是新手快…...

Obsidian PDF++插件技术架构:实现原生PDF标注与知识图谱集成

Obsidian PDF插件技术架构:实现原生PDF标注与知识图谱集成 【免费下载链接】obsidian-pdf-plus PDF: the most Obsidian-native PDF annotation & viewing tool ever. Comes with optional Vim keybindings. 项目地址: https://gitcode.com/gh_mirrors/ob/obs…...

终极网盘直链下载助手:告别限速的完整指南

终极网盘直链下载助手:告别限速的完整指南 【免费下载链接】Online-disk-direct-link-download-assistant 一个基于 JavaScript 的网盘文件下载地址获取工具。基于【网盘直链下载助手】修改 ,支持 百度网盘 / 阿里云盘 / 中国移动云盘 / 天翼云盘 / 迅雷…...

从手机到Wi-Fi:拆解你身边那些‘看不见’的射频滤波器(SAW/BAW/陶瓷)

从手机到Wi-Fi:拆解你身边那些‘看不见’的射频滤波器(SAW/BAW/陶瓷) 当你用手机刷视频、连Wi-Fi打游戏时,有没有想过这些无线信号是如何在复杂的电磁环境中保持稳定的?答案就藏在那些米粒大小的射频滤波器里。这些不起…...

拆解IDT7205异步FIFO:从引脚时序到状态机,一个嵌入式老兵的调试笔记

一位嵌入式工程师的IDT7205异步FIFO实战手记 第一次拿到IDT7205这颗异步FIFO芯片时,我本以为按照常规思路就能轻松搞定。然而在实际调试过程中,那些看似简单的时序图背后隐藏着不少"坑"。本文将分享我从零开始理解并成功应用IDT7205的全过程&a…...

AssetRipper终极指南:从游戏资源中提取宝藏的完整实战教程

AssetRipper终极指南:从游戏资源中提取宝藏的完整实战教程 【免费下载链接】AssetRipper GUI Application to work with engine assets, asset bundles, and serialized files 项目地址: https://gitcode.com/GitHub_Trending/as/AssetRipper 你是否曾经玩过…...

5步掌握SMUDebugTool:AMD Ryzen硬件调试与性能调优完整指南

5步掌握SMUDebugTool:AMD Ryzen硬件调试与性能调优完整指南 【免费下载链接】SMUDebugTool A d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table. 项目地址: https…...

WaveTools终极指南:解锁《鸣潮》120帧的完整解决方案

WaveTools终极指南:解锁《鸣潮》120帧的完整解决方案 【免费下载链接】WaveTools 🧰鸣潮工具箱 项目地址: https://gitcode.com/gh_mirrors/wa/WaveTools 想要在《鸣潮》中体验丝滑流畅的120帧游戏画面吗?WaveTools鸣潮工具箱正是你需…...

如何快速构建Python金融数据采集系统:完整实战指南

如何快速构建Python金融数据采集系统:完整实战指南 【免费下载链接】pywencai 获取同花顺问财数据 项目地址: https://gitcode.com/gh_mirrors/py/pywencai 在量化投资和金融数据分析领域,获取高质量的金融数据是每个分析师和投资者的核心需求。传…...

NVIDIA Profile Inspector完全指南:免费解锁显卡200+隐藏参数

NVIDIA Profile Inspector完全指南:免费解锁显卡200隐藏参数 【免费下载链接】nvidiaProfileInspector 项目地址: https://gitcode.com/gh_mirrors/nv/nvidiaProfileInspector NVIDIA Profile Inspector是一款强大的开源显卡优化工具,能够让你访…...

题解:洛谷 P6033 [NOIP 2004 提高组] 合并果子 加强版

本文分享的必刷题目是从蓝桥云课、洛谷、AcWing等知名刷题平台精心挑选而来,并结合各平台提供的算法标签和难度等级进行了系统分类。题目涵盖了从基础到进阶的多种算法和数据结构,旨在为不同阶段的编程学习者提供一条清晰、平稳的学习提升路径。 欢迎大家订阅我的专栏:算法…...

Android Studio安装后必做的5件事:从汉化乱码到模拟器提速的完整配置清单

Android Studio安装后必做的5件事:从汉化乱码到模拟器提速的完整配置清单 刚装好Android Studio的兴奋感,往往会在打开IDE的瞬间被各种小问题冲淡——控制台里看不懂的乱码、慢到怀疑人生的模拟器、每次启动都要重新加载的旧项目...这些问题看似微不足道…...

题解:洛谷 B3940 [GESP样题 四级] 填幻方

本文分享的必刷题目是从蓝桥云课、洛谷、AcWing等知名刷题平台精心挑选而来,并结合各平台提供的算法标签和难度等级进行了系统分类。题目涵盖了从基础到进阶的多种算法和数据结构,旨在为不同阶段的编程学习者提供一条清晰、平稳的学习提升路径。 欢迎大家订阅我的专栏:算法…...

Bioicons:如何用3000+免费矢量图标彻底改变科研可视化体验?

Bioicons:如何用3000免费矢量图标彻底改变科研可视化体验? 【免费下载链接】bioicons A library of free open source icons for science illustrations in biology and chemistry 项目地址: https://gitcode.com/gh_mirrors/bi/bioicons 如果你是…...

dotfiles社区资源:如何从其他开发者那里获取灵感

dotfiles社区资源:如何从其他开发者那里获取灵感 【免费下载链接】dotfiles Get started with your own dotfiles. 项目地址: https://gitcode.com/gh_mirrors/dotfiles6/dotfiles dotfiles是开发者个性化工作环境的核心,通过学习开源社区中优秀的…...

飞书文档批量导出神器:3分钟搞定700+文档迁移,支持全平台运行

飞书文档批量导出神器:3分钟搞定700文档迁移,支持全平台运行 【免费下载链接】feishu-doc-export 飞书文档导出服务 项目地址: https://gitcode.com/gh_mirrors/fe/feishu-doc-export 还在为团队知识库迁移而头疼吗?面对飞书中堆积如山…...

LTSF-Linear参数调优技巧:10个关键设置让你的预测精度提升50%

LTSF-Linear参数调优技巧:10个关键设置让你的预测精度提升50% 【免费下载链接】LTSF-Linear [AAAI-23 Oral] Official implementation of the paper "Are Transformers Effective for Time Series Forecasting?" 项目地址: https://gitcode.com/gh_mir…...

2026年GPT-5完全指南:从发布到应用,一文讲透

2026年GPT-5完全指南:从发布到应用,一文讲透2025年10月发布、2026年已进化到GPT-5.4——最详细的中文技术解析前言 2025年10月,OpenAI正式发布了GPT-5。消息一出,整个AI圈沸腾了——从GPT-4到GPT-5,整整一年半的等待。…...

剪映自动化终极指南:用Python脚本批量处理视频的完整教程

剪映自动化终极指南:用Python脚本批量处理视频的完整教程 【免费下载链接】JianYingApi Third Party JianYing Api. 第三方剪映Api 项目地址: https://gitcode.com/gh_mirrors/ji/JianYingApi 还在为重复的视频剪辑工作烦恼吗?每天需要处理几十个…...

小白也能搞定的DeOldify服务监控:安装、配置、可视化一步到位

小白也能搞定的DeOldify服务监控:安装、配置、可视化一步到位 1. 为什么需要监控DeOldify服务 当你成功部署了DeOldify图像上色服务后,最常遇到的困惑可能是:服务现在运行得怎么样?GPU资源够用吗?内存会不会爆掉&…...

从0到1搭建工业级智能监控系统:YOLOv8+ByteTrack的多目标检测与跟踪实践

在智能监控场景中,单纯的目标检测只能告诉你“画面里有什么”,而结合跟踪技术才能回答“这个目标在做什么、去了哪里”。比如交通监控中,不仅要识别车辆,还要跟踪其行驶轨迹计算车速;园区安防里,不仅要检测人员,还要判断是否有异常徘徊。 本文基于YOLOv8(检测)+ByteT…...